IN ASIA MINOR
RUSSIAN OFFENSIVE NEAR ERZERUM f . Australian-New Zealand Oablo Association. London, July 14. A. Russian official message states:— Our offensive westwards of'Erzerum is developing' with great success. We captured another whole line of fortified positions. One of our legimcnts, .after repulsing twelve desperate attacks, is now attacking and making considerable progross. ' THRUST IN ARMENIA TUU.KS DRIVEN 25 MILES) (Roc. July IG, 5.5 p.m.); . Petronrad,; July 15. Russian comiminiquep show' that Grand Duke Nicholas organised a vigorous thrust in Armenia along tho -valley of the Euphrates, where tho Russians, in a lew days, advanced 25 miles in tho direc- ' tion of the military depot' Erzingan, In miles'distant. The Turks have already lost practically all that they had gained in their reoent offensive. FURTHER RUSSIAN SUCCESS. BATTLE NEAH MUSH.' (Rec. July 16, 5.5 p.m.) London, July 15. A Russian communique says: "A series of new Turkish positions west .of Erzerum have been captured. Wo are now fifteen vorsts (10 miles) from Raibnr.. "The battle south-west of Mush is developing successfully."
